#b206a2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b206a2 is composed of 69.8% red, 2.4%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.6% magenta, 9%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 305.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 36.1%. #b206a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#650045.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#b206a2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b206a2 has RGB values of R:178, G:6,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.09,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11667106.

Shades and Tints of #b206a2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070007 is the darkest color, while #fff3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b206a2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5b5d is the less saturated color, while #b206a2 is the most saturated one.
